So, the Keystep has CV outputs, and the Volca Modular has a "CV-IN" module... should be simple, right? For a CV newbie, it was a little more work than I was expecting. Here's what I did in four simple steps: 02:05 Plug in a cable Link to the exact cable I'm using: https://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B0757Q5FB8 04:54 Make a patch For pitch, run the pitch output of the CV-IN module (marked by a note with a line through it) into the pitch input of the SOURCE module (marked by the same symbol). For gate, run the top output of the CV-IN module to the gate input of the FUNCTIONS module (upper-leftmost port). 08:45 MIDI control center settings With the keystep plugged in, open the MIDI control center. Set 0V MIDI Note to whichever value sounds closest to the tuning you want (in my case this is C#0). 11:09 Tuning Hook up a tuner to the headphone jack of the Volca Modular. In the video, I'm using a Korg CA-40. While holding down a key on the Keystep and the FUNC key on the Volca Modular, turn the RATIO knob until the note on your tuner matches the note you're holding down on the Keystep.
